About Shri Mata Mansa Devi Mandir Haridwar
Mansa Devi Temple is located in Haridwar and is dedicated to Maa Mansa Devi. It is located at the top of the Bilwa Parvat on the Sivalik Hills. Pilgrims can take a ropeway service or walk towards the temple. Navaratri is the important festival of this temple.
How to Reach Haridwar Mansa Devi Temple
You can reach Haridwar by various modes of transportation, like trains, flights and buses.
By Rail
Haridwar Junction Railway Station is the closest to the Mansa Devi Temple. The distance between Mansa Devi Temple and Haridwar Railway Station is around 3.1 km.
By Air
Jolly Grant Domestic Airport, Dehradun, is the nearest airport to Mansa Devi Temple. The Mansa Devi Temple is around 40.8 km away from the Dehradun Airport.
By Road
The road connectivity is very well maintained in Uttarakhand state. Haridwar Bus Depot is the nearest bus stop to Mansa Devi Temple. Direct buses from major cities of Uttarakhand are available to reach Haridwar. The distance between the temple and the bus depot is approximately 3.1 km.
Best Time to Visit Mansa Devi Temple
October to March is the best time to visit Mansa Devi Temple, Haridwar.

1. What role does Mata Mansa Devi play in our history?
Ans. The Mata Mansa Devi is considered the sister of the snake Vasuki. She is said to have sprung from Lord Shiva’s intelligence. Devotees frequently tie threads to a holy tree at the temple, coming to untie them once their desires are granted, since she is renowned as the wish-fulfilling goddess.
2. What are the timings and rates for the ropeway?
Ans. From April through October, the ropeway is open from 6:30 AM to 5:00 PM; in other months, it is open from 8:30 AM to 5:00 PM. You can buy combo tickets for Mata Mansa Devi and Mata Chandi Devi, which cost Rs. 349 for adults and Rs. 195 for children. The age range is between 2-4. These tickets are valid for two days.
